Midjourney launches V1 – its first AI video tool

Midjourney has officially released the Midjourney V1 AI video generation model, a groundbreaking tool that lets users animate still images into short video clips. This marks a major expansion for the platform, which until now was strictly an image-generation service. Here’s what you need to know about Midjourney V1 AI video generation model, why it’s made waves, and what’s next.

Midjourney was one of the early names in the space for AI-generated still images, even as other platforms have pushed the forefront of the discussions around artificial intelligence development. Google’s latest I/O conference included several new tools for AI generated video, such as the text-to-video Veo 3 model and a tool for filmmakers called Flow. OpenAI’s Sora, which debuted last year, is also a text-to-video option, while the more recent Firefly Video Model from Adobe can create video from a text or image prompt.

“Our goal is to give you something fun, easy, beautiful, and affordable so that everyone can explore. We think we’ve struck a solid balance,” says the June 18 blog post, which is signed “David” (presumably Midjourney founder and CEO David Holz).

What is Midjourney V1 AI video generation model?

  • Image-to-video capability: Users can now take any image—created or uploaded—and press “Animate” to generate a 5‑second clip. Extensions allow up to 21 seconds total.

  • Motion controls: Choose between low-motion for subtle effects or high-motion for dynamic scenes. You can also switch between automatic and manual prompts to customize the animation .

  • Accessible platforms: Available via both Midjourney’s website and Discord, making it easy to try straight from your existing workflow.

The company also is allowing users to animate images “uploaded from outside of Midjourney.” To do this, users can drag an image to the prompt bar and mark it as a “start frame,” then type a motion prompt to describe how they want it to be animated.

Pricing and availability

Midjourney has announced that its V1 video‑generation model will cost eight times more than standard image generation, meaning users will deplete their monthly generation quotas much faster when creating videos.

The most cost‑effective way to try V1 at launch is through Midjourney’s $ 10‑per‑month Basic plan. The $ 60‑per‑month Pro plan and $ 120‑per‑month Mega plan offer unlimited video production in the slower “Relax” mode, which queues jobs and may take longer to process. Midjourney intends to review its video‑model pricing within the next month.

Midjourney CEO David Holz revealed in a blog post that their AI‑video model is merely a stepping stone toward a broader objective: developing AI models capable of real‑time open‑world simulations.

Midjourney launches V1David Holz : CEO of Midjourney

Following the V1 release, Midjourney plans to develop AI models for 3D rendering and real‑time applications.

Legal headwinds & Final Thoughts

Midjourney’s foray into video isn’t without consequences. The company is facing a major lawsuit from Disney and Universal, citing concerns over copyright infringement—especially given the ability to animate potentially protected content. The studios highlight that V1 video creation “makes things move” in unauthorized ways and could infringe their IP .

Despite the legal firestorm, Midjourney founder David Holz describes V1 as “a stepping stone” toward more ambitious projects, like real-time open-world simulations.
